1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What are the two products of photosynthesis?
Back
Oxygen and Sugar
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Is Oxygen a Raw Material (Ingredient) or Product of Photosynthesis?
Back
Product
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What organelle produces food using radiant energy?
Back
A chloroplast produces food using radiant energy.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How do photosynthesis and cellular respiration differ in terms of carbon dioxide?
Back
Photosynthesis uses carbon dioxide, while cellular respiration produces carbon dioxide.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What process does the chloroplast perform?
Back
Photosynthesis.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the primary function of photosynthesis?
Back
To convert light energy into chemical energy stored in glucose.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the equation for photosynthesis?
Back
6CO2 + 6H2O + light energy → C6H12O6 + 6O2
